网站开发的艺术与科学

Tandou888 2024-04-20 阅读:71 评论:0
青衣网络:网站开发的艺术与科学 目录: 1. 网站开发的基础知识 2. 用户体验设计的重要性 3. 前端技术的最新趋势 4. 后端架构的考量因素 5. 安全性在网站开发中的作用 6. 搜索引擎优化(SEO)策略 7. 移动优先与响应式设计...

青衣网络:网站开发的艺术与科学

目录: 1. 网站开发的基础知识 2. 用户体验设计的重要性 3. 前端技术的最新趋势 4. 后端架构的考量因素 5. 安全性在网站开发中的作用 6. 搜索引擎优化(SEO)策略 7. 移动优先与响应式设计 8. 网站性能优化的实践 9. 网站开发工具和资源 10. 未来网站开发的展望

正文:

网站开发的基础知识 网站开发是一个涉及多个技术和学科的过程,它包括网页设计、编程、用户界面设计和用户体验设计。一个成功的网站不仅要外观吸引人,还要易于使用,快速加载,并且在各种设备上都能良好地工作。了解HTML、CSS和JavaScript是网站开发的基石,这些技术使得创建静态页面和动态交互成为可能。

用户体验设计的重要性 用户体验(UX)设计是确保网站访问者能够愉快和有效地使用网站的关键。一个好的UX设计不仅关注网站的外观,还包括如何组织内容,如何引导用户完成任务,以及如何确保网站的可访问性。通过用户研究和测试,开发者可以更好地理解目标受众的需求,并据此设计出更符合用户期望的网站。

前端技术的最新趋势 前端开发是创建网站用户界面的过程,它涉及到的技术不断进化。最新的趋势包括使用CSS框架如Bootstrap进行快速原型设计,以及采用Vue.js或React等现代JavaScript框架来构建更动态的用户界面。这些技术提高了开发效率,同时也提升了用户的互动体验。

后端架构的考量因素 后端开发处理的是服务器、数据库和应用的逻辑。选择合适的后端架构对于网站的可扩展性、安全性和维护性至关重要。流行的后端技术包括Node.js、Ruby on Rails、Django等。开发者需要考虑如何处理数据存储、服务器的负载平衡以及如何实现API的RESTful设计。

安全性在网站开发中的作用 随着网络攻击的增加,安全性在网站开发中变得越来越重要。开发者需要采取措施保护网站免受SQL注入、跨站脚本(XSS)和跨站请求伪造(CSRF)等常见安全威胁。这包括使用HTTPS、数据加密、定期更新软件以及实施强密码政策等措施。

搜索引擎优化(SEO)策略 为了让网站在搜索引擎中获得更高的排名,开发者必须实施有效的SEO策略。这包括优化网站的元标签、使用合适的关键词、提高网站的加载速度以及构建高质量的反向链接。良好的SEO实践不仅有助于提高网站的可见性,还能吸引更多的潜在客户。

移动优先与响应式设计 随着移动设备的普及,移动优先和响应式设计成为了网站开发的标准。这意味着网站必须在小屏幕上同样有效,而且能够根据不同设备的屏幕大小调整布局。使用媒体查询和弹性布局技术可以帮助开发者创建适应不同分辨率的网站。

网站性能优化的实践 网站的性能直接影响用户体验和转化率。开发者需要优化图片大小、最小化代码、利用浏览器缓存以及减少HTTP请求等来加快网站的加载时间。CDN的使用也可以帮助提高全球用户的访问速度。

网站开发工具和资源 为了提高开发效率,开发者可以利用各种工具和资源。这包括代码编辑器、版本控制系统、调试工具以及在线社区和文档。使用这些资源可以帮助开发者更快地解决问题,并保持对最新技术的了解。

未来网站开发的展望 未来的网站开发将更加注重人工智能、机器学习和大数据的整合。这将使网站能够提供更个性化的内容和更智能的用户体验。同时,随着量子计算的发展,网站的安全性和性能也将面临新的挑战和机遇。

问答: 问:为什么用户体验设计对网站开发如此重要? 答:用户体验设计决定了用户在使用网站时的感受和效率。一个好的用户体验设计可以降低跳出率,提高用户满意度和转化率,从而直接影响网站的成功率。

问:如何确保网站的安全性? 答:确保网站的安全性需要采取多层防护措施,包括使用HTTPS加密数据传输,定期更新系统和应用程序以修补安全漏洞,以及对用户输入进行验证以防止注入攻击。此外,还应该对网站进行定期的安全审计和渗透测试。

版权声明

本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。

分享:

扫一扫在手机阅读、分享本文

热门文章
  • 网站维护:从基础到高级的全面指南

    网站维护:从基础到高级的全面指南
    标题:网站维护:从基础到高级的全面指南 目录: 1. 网站维护的重要性 2. 网站维护的基本步骤 3. 网站维护的高级技巧 4. 网站维护的常见问题及解决方案 5. 网站维护的未来趋势 正文: 1. 网站维护的重要性 网站维护是确保网站长期稳定运行、提供良好用户体验的关键。一个未经维护的网站可能会出现各种问题,如加载速度慢、页面错误、数据丢失等,这些问题不仅会影响用户的使用体验,还可能导致搜索引擎排名下降,进而影响网站的业务发展。因此,定期对网站进行维护是非常必要的。...
  • 微信小程序开发:从入门到精通的全面指南

    微信小程序开发:从入门到精通的全面指南
    标题:微信小程序开发:从入门到精通的全面指南 目录: 1. 微信小程序概述 2. 准备工作 3. 基础架构与开发工具 4. 用户界面设计原则 5. 核心功能实现 6. 性能优化技巧 7. 发布与推广策略 8. 常见问题及解决方案 9. 未来发展趋势预测 10. 总结 正文 1. 微信小程序概述 微信小程序是一种轻量级应用,无需下载安装即可在微信内直接使用。自2017年推出以来,它已成为连接用户与服务的重要桥梁,广泛应用于电商、教育、医疗等多个领域。 2. 准备工作 在...
  • 揭秘百度排名优化策略:提升在线可见性的关键步骤

    揭秘百度排名优化策略:提升在线可见性的关键步骤
    标题:揭秘百度排名优化策略:提升在线可见性的关键步骤 目录: 1. 关键词研究的深度分析 2. 高质量内容的创建与优化 3. 网站结构的搜索引擎友好设计 4. 移动优先策略的实施 5. 本地SEO的精准定位 6. 链接建设的策略与执行 7. 用户体验的持续改进 8. 社交媒体整合的重要性 9. 数据分析与调整 10. 避免常见错误的策略 正文: 关键词研究的深度分析 在百度排名优化的过程中,关键词研究是基础也是关键。通过对目标受众搜索习惯的深入了解,可以挖掘出高价值关键词...
  • 百度排名机制解析与优化策略

    百度排名机制解析与优化策略
    标题:百度排名机制解析与优化策略 目录: 1. 百度排名的基本概念 2. 影响百度排名的主要因素 3. 如何提高百度排名 4. 百度排名优化的注意事项 5. 百度排名的未来趋势 正文: 1. 百度排名的基本概念 百度排名,即在百度搜索结果页面(SERP)上,网站或网页根据相关性和重要性被赋予的位置。排名越靠前,意味着更多的曝光机会和流量。理解百度排名机制对于SEO(搜索引擎优化)至关重要。 2. 影响百度排名的主要因素 百度的排名算法考虑多种因素,包括但不限于关键词使...
  • 微信小程序开发:从入门到精通

    微信小程序开发:从入门到精通
    标题:微信小程序开发:从入门到精通 目录: 一、微信小程序概述 二、开发环境搭建 三、基础语法与组件 四、页面布局与样式 五、数据绑定与事件处理 六、API与接口调用 七、发布与推广 八、常见问题解答 正文: 一、微信小程序概述 微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。作为一种新型的应用形态,微信小程序具有轻量级、便捷性和高效性的特点。 二、开发环境搭建 要开始微信小程序的开发,首先需要搭...